Ingredients List

Let’s gather what we need to make these delightful Air Fryer S’mores Crescent Rolls! Here’s what you’ll be working with:

  • 1 can of crescent roll dough: This is the magic that holds everything together! Look for the flaky, buttery dough that rolls out easily.
  • 1 cup of mini marshmallows: These little guys are going to give you that ooey-gooey goodness. They melt perfectly and add that classic s’mores flavor.
  • 1 cup of chocolate chips: Use your favorite type! Whether it’s semi-sweet, milk chocolate, or even dark chocolate, they’ll create a rich, melty filling.
  • Cooking spray: Just a light mist in the air fryer basket ensures your rolls don’t stick and get that lovely golden brown color.

How to Prepare Air Fryer S’mores Crescent Rolls

Now that we have our ingredients all set, let’s jump into making these scrumptious Air Fryer S’mores Crescent Rolls! It’s really a straightforward process that’s almost foolproof. Just follow these steps, and you’ll be enjoying your gooey treats in no time!

Step-by-Step Instructions

  1. Preheat the air fryer: First things first, set your air fryer to 350°F. Preheating is crucial because it helps the rolls cook evenly and achieve that gorgeous golden-brown color.
  2. Unroll the crescent roll dough: Carefully open your can of crescent roll dough. I like to do this on a clean surface. Gently unroll it and separate the triangles. Don’t worry if they don’t look perfect; they’ll still taste amazing!
  3. Add the filling: At the wide end of each triangle, place a few chocolate chips and a generous sprinkle of mini marshmallows. Don’t skimp here—you want that delicious filling to ooze out when they bake!
  4. Roll it up: Starting from the wide end, roll the dough tightly towards the point of the triangle. Make sure to pinch the seams to seal them well, so none of that yummy filling escapes during cooking!
  5. Prepare the air fryer basket: Give your air fryer basket a quick spray with cooking spray. This little step is essential to prevent sticking and ensures those rolls come out beautifully.
  6. Arrange the rolls: Place your rolled crescent dough in the air fryer basket, making sure to leave a little space between each one. This gives them room to puff up and get perfectly crispy.
  7. Air fry away: Pop the basket into the air fryer and set the timer for 5-7 minutes. Keep an eye on them, as air fryers can vary. You’re looking for that golden-brown perfection!
  8. Let them cool: Once they’re done, carefully remove the rolls from the air fryer and let them cool slightly. Trust me, the wait will be worth it when you take that first bite!

Tips for Success

Ready to make sure your Air Fryer S’mores Crescent Rolls turn out perfectly? I’ve got some pro tips to help you nail it every time!

  • Even spacing is key: When placing your rolls in the air fryer basket, make sure to leave enough space between each one. This allows hot air to circulate properly, giving you that crispy, golden exterior without any soggy spots. Trust me, they’ll puff up beautifully!
  • Keep an eye on the time: Air fryers can vary in how they cook, so don’t be afraid to check on your rolls a minute or two before the timer goes off. You want that lovely golden brown, and sometimes they can cook a bit faster than expected.
  • Use parchment paper: If you’re worried about sticking, you can line the air fryer basket with parchment paper. Just make sure to cut it to size and leave some space for airflow. This will make cleanup a breeze!
  • Experiment with fillings: While chocolate and marshmallows are classic, don’t hesitate to get creative! Try adding some peanut butter or crushed nuts for extra flavor and texture. You could even throw in some caramel bits if you’re feeling adventurous!
  • Cool before serving: I know it’s hard to wait, but letting the rolls cool for a minute or two after air frying will help the filling set a little bit. This way, you won’t end up with a gooey mess when you take that first bite!

Variations for Air Fryer S’mores Crescent Rolls

If you’re like me and love to mix things up in the kitchen, you’ll be thrilled to know there are so many fun variations for these Air Fryer S’mores Crescent Rolls! Here are a few ideas to get your creative juices flowing:

  • Different types of chocolate: Swap out the regular chocolate chips for white chocolate, dark chocolate, or even flavored chocolate like mint or raspberry. Each type brings its own unique twist to the classic s’mores flavor!
  • Peanut butter goodness: Spread a thin layer of peanut butter on the crescent dough before adding the chocolate chips and marshmallows. This adds a rich, nutty flavor that makes every bite even more satisfying!
  • Nutty crunch: Toss in some chopped nuts like pecans, walnuts, or almonds along with the chocolate and marshmallows for an added crunch. It’s a delightful contrast to the gooey filling!
  • Caramel surprise: Drizzle some caramel sauce over the chocolate and marshmallows before rolling them up. The melted caramel adds a sweet, sticky twist that will have everyone reaching for seconds!
  • Fruit-infused: Try adding some fresh or dried fruit, like sliced strawberries or bananas, along with the chocolate and marshmallows. It’s a fun way to add a burst of freshness to your rolls!

Storage & Reheating Instructions

So, you’ve made a batch of these mouthwatering Air Fryer S’mores Crescent Rolls, and now you have some leftovers. First off, let me say, great job! But what do you do with those delicious rolls that are just begging to be enjoyed again?

To store your leftover rolls, simply place them in an airtight container once they’ve cooled down. This keeps them fresh and helps maintain that lovely, flaky texture. You can pop them in the fridge for about 3-4 days, but trust me, they probably won’t last that long!

Now, when it comes to reheating, you want to bring back that warm, gooey goodness without turning them into a soggy mess. I suggest using your air fryer again for reheating. Just preheat it to 350°F, place the rolls in the basket, and air fry for about 2-3 minutes. This will help revive that crispy exterior while ensuring the chocolate and marshmallows get nice and melty again.

If you don’t have your air fryer handy, you can use the oven instead. Preheat your oven to 350°F, place the rolls on a baking sheet, and heat them for about 5-7 minutes. Just make sure to keep an eye on them, so they don’t overcook!

FAQ Section

Got questions about making these scrumptious Air Fryer S’mores Crescent Rolls? Don’t worry, I’ve got you covered! Here are some common questions that pop up, along with my answers to help you out:

  • Can I use a different type of dough? Absolutely! While crescent roll dough is my go-to for that flaky texture, you can experiment with other doughs like puff pastry or even homemade dough if you’re feeling adventurous. Just keep in mind that cooking times may vary, so keep an eye on them!
  • What if I don’t have mini marshmallows? No problem! You can use regular marshmallows, but I recommend cutting them in half to ensure they fit nicely in the rolls. You could also try marshmallow fluff for a different texture—just be cautious not to overfill!
  • How do I know when they’re done cooking? The best way to check is by looking for that golden-brown color on the outside. If you want to be extra sure, you can do a gentle poke test; they should feel firm yet springy when done. A minute or two of extra cooking can make a big difference, so keep checking!
  • Can I make these ahead of time? You can definitely prep the rolls ahead of time! Just roll them up and store them in the fridge for a few hours before air frying. However, I recommend air frying them fresh for the best texture. If you must, you can reheat them as described earlier.
  • What’s a good way to serve these rolls? These Air Fryer S’mores Crescent Rolls are delightful on their own, but you can jazz them up with a drizzle of chocolate or caramel sauce on top! Serve them with a scoop of ice cream for an extra indulgent treat, or pair them with fresh fruit for a fun twist.

Air Fryer S'mores Crescent Rolls

Air Fryer S’mores Crescent Rolls: 7 Joyful Bites to Love

Delicious Air Fryer S’mores Crescent Rolls made with chocolate and marshmallows.

  • Total Time: 17 minutes
  • Yield: 8 rolls 1x

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 can crescent roll dough
  • 1 cup mini marshmallows
  • 1 cup chocolate chips
  • Cooking spray

Instructions

  1. Preheat the air fryer to 350°F.
  2. Unroll the crescent roll dough on a clean surface.
  3. Place a few chocolate chips and marshmallows at the wide end of each triangle.
  4. Roll the dough tightly from the wide end to the point.
  5. Spray the air fryer basket with cooking spray.
  6. Place the rolls in the basket leaving space between them.
  7. Air fry for 5-7 minutes until golden brown.
  8. Remove and let cool slightly before serving.
